What you will be doing

As a key part of the Customer Sales & Service Center (CSSC) Kazakhstan team, you'll create impact by Ensuring timely and compliant delivery of Grundfos products across Kazakhstan by expertly managing customs documentation, broker coordination, and warehouse operations..

Your main responsibilities include:

  • Prepare and manage all custom clearance documentation, coordinating with brokers to ensure timely and compliant import processing
  • Communicate with international colleagues in Hungary and China to monitor delivery schedules, resolve supply issues, and track shipment lead times
  • Oversee warehouse receiving operations — verify incoming deliveries, identify discrepancies or damage, and drive resolution with suppliers
  • Coordinate EAC certificates and import permits by working closely with the certification coordinator and other internal departments
  • Manage vendor invoices related to customs clearance, post them in SAP, and request approvals for payment
  • Prepare monthly reports for Finance including GIT, stock, scrap, and net cost analysis of imported goods with customs duties
